I placed and won a bid online with Auction Nation at online.auctionnation.com  on a 2000 Isuzu Rodeo. When I went to pick up the vehicle the windshield was cracked in several places. The pictures that were posted in the ad on their site when I placed the bid DID NOT show a broken windshield. They misrepresented the vehicle. I decided to go ahead and purchase the vehicle anyway since I drove all the way to Phoenix, AZ from Show low, AZ.

As I was pulling off their lot at 3441 w. Grand Avenue the transmission on the rodeo slipped. It continued to slip as I was driving and then finally it stopped shifting all together. I was less than 2 miles away from the Auction Lot and the transmission WOULD NOT go into gear at all. I was stranded.I had a mechanic come look at the Rodeo and was advised that the transmission was completely out.

I immediately called the manager of Auction Nation at 602-277-0941 to inform him of the vehicle being undriveable, that I was broke down a few miles up the road, and that the transmission went out. He told me that the ad posted online for the Rodeo stated that the transmission was slipping and ready to go out at anytime. That is a big fat lie. I told him the ad never stated anything about the transmission at all or the cracked windshield. This is false advertising. I double-checked the ad and it DID NOT state anything about either problem. The manager told me “sorry all sales are final! Nothing we can do to help you.” I am completely devastated. I cannot believe this is how they do business, so heartless!

So here I sit, stranded in Phoenix with a broken down car I just paid $1000 for and I am less than 2 miles from the Auction lot. I live in Show low and have no idea how I am going to get home now.
